Job Description

Company: Leadec

Job Position: Facility Manager

Job Type: Full Time Salaried

Location: Holland, Michigan

Reports to: General Manager

Department: North American Operations

Essential Duties and Responsibilities: FM managing on site housekeeping activities as well as subcontracted services of roads and grounds, pest control, and elevator maintenance.

  • Oversight of all Leadec operations at the site
  • Operates within the Leadec Values to promote an overall positive Work safely at all time and drive safety prevention as a personal responsibility.
  • Maintain high ethical standards and an appropriate level of confidentiality.
  • Ensures that all safety guidelines at the site are adhered to in accordance with our safety program requirements.
  • Provide technical knowledge and problem-solving skills to encourage better decision making.
  • Drive successful implementation of Leadec and Customer strategic initiatives.
  • Manages all required documentation reporting for both internal and customer needs.
  • Relationship management -- both internally within Leadec and externally between Leadec, Leadec's Customers and Leadec's business partners
  • Manage KPI's for Safety, Quality, Delivery, Cost, Morale, and Environment
  • Develop & maintain process controls for the most efficient method of performing assigned Scope of Work (SOW) in the most cost-effective way, at a very high standard.
  • Ability to define problems, collect data, establish facts, draw valid conclusions, and determine a clear path of action with goals and metrics in all areas of responsibility.
  • All other duties as assigned by Leadec manager.
